** The kitchen remodeling market in Mount Vernon, Ohio, is characteristic of a smaller Midwestern city. The competition is not saturated with large national chains, but rather consists of a handful of established local contractors and regional specialists who serve the broader Knox County area. This creates a market where reputation, word-of-mouth, and proven longevity are paramount. The average quality of service is generally high among the top-tier providers, as they rely on local referrals for sustained business. Homeowners can expect a more personalized service experience compared to larger metropolitan areas. In terms of pricing, Mount Vernon is considered a moderately priced market. A full kitchen remodel can vary widely but typically ranges from $15,000 for a more basic update with refaced cabinets and new countertops to $50,000+ for a high-end, full-gut renovation with custom cabinetry, premium stone countertops, and layout changes. The limited number of dedicated specialists means it is crucial for homeowners to plan ahead, as lead times for reputable contractors can be several months.

For a full remodel in our area, including new cabinets, countertops, flooring, appliances, and labor, homeowners should budget between $25,000 and $60,000, with mid-range projects typically landing around $40,000. Costs are influenced by material choices, the age of your home (which may require updates to plumbing or electrical to meet current Ohio building codes), and local labor rates. It's wise to get 3-4 detailed estimates from licensed local contractors to understand the specific market pricing for your project scope.
Knox County experiences all four seasons, which can impact material deliveries and project schedules. Winter can cause delays due to snow and ice, especially for any crews traveling from outside the immediate area, while spring can be rainy. The most reliable times to start a remodel for optimal scheduling are typically late spring through early fall. However, indoor work can proceed year-round with a reputable local contractor who plans for seasonal contingencies.
Yes, most structural, electrical, and plumbing work in Mount Vernon requires permits from the City's Building and Zoning Department. This ensures work complies with Ohio Building Code (OBC) and local ordinances, which is crucial for safety and resale. A key local consideration in older Mount Vernon homes is ensuring updates meet current code, especially with knob-and-tube wiring or older galvanized pipes. Your contractor should typically handle pulling all necessary permits.

In older homes, it's common to discover outdated wiring that needs full replacement, plumbing lines that are corroded or not to current code, and structural surprises like non-load-bearing walls that were assumed to be load-bearing. Additionally, you may find uneven floors or subfloors in need of leveling. A reputable local contractor will budget a contingency (typically 10-20%) and conduct a thorough inspection during the estimate phase to minimize surprises.
